When you think of New York City, what comes to your mind? The outsiders usually say that it’s full of diversity, a fast-paced life, innovation, and culture. But anyone who’s ever lived in NYC knows life there isn’t as glamorous as it looks. After all, when you have 8M people staying in one place, things are bound to get chaotic.

The rental property market in the city is quite intense—the average price for a studio apartment there is $2,830. This is a 32 percent increase compared to last year. While some flats tend to be in perfect shape, others come with frustrating design flaws, missing bathrooms, or showers in the kitchen.
